I have three helmets one is a Seven-Seven (cycle gear special) that I had on when I crashed last year. The helmet has scratches and a dent on the right rear side.
The second a Icon I bought at a yard sale for $20 looks brand new.
Third is my SHOEI I bought brand new this year, obviously its good
The question is how do you know if one is still safe to use? I realize the seven seven one is junk from the impact but can you send helmets any where to be tested. I imagine taking the liner out and looking for cracks but whats every one else opinion on it?
I found this on SHOEI web site also I emailed them to see what they had to say about life span under normal wear and tear, Yes, Shoei offers a free impact inspection service for any Shoei helmet.* To have your helmet inspected, please send it to;
Shoei Helmets
3002 Dow Ave
Suite 128
Tustin, CA 92780
Attn: Inspections
Be sure to include a letter with a brief description of the issue with the helmet, as well as a daytime phone number and return address. Once we receive the helmet it will take 1-3 business days to complete the inspection. Upon completion the helmet is returned to you with a letter stating the findings of our inspection. Your helmet is returned to you if it passes the inspection or not. There is no charge for the inspection, and the UPS Ground return shipping is free. To see a video on how to pack your helmet for shipping, click here.
*For USA and Canada residents only.
